But who will be peak at the end of August?

The Betfair experts have forecasted who will be coroneted Premier League champions excluding why not have a fissure at the far more complicated exercise of betting on who will be king of August…

Man United and Fulham are simply playing two times in August, which denotes they’d be relying on everybody else losing one of their opening three to end the month on pinnacle.

We can mark them off.

Simply one recently promoted squad – Bolton in 2001-02 – have led the Premier League table at the end of August.

Thank you for your attention West Brom, Stoke and Hull.

Excluding Liverpool‘s contentious Evans/Houllier Corporation in 1998-99, the simply recently appointed executives to take their group to crown on August 31 were Mike Walker (Norwich, 1992-93) and Roy Hodgson (Blackburn 1997-98).

It hasn’t occurred since, which is menacing for Blackburn, Chelsea and Man City.

For the final 11 seasons, the group that have topped the table at the ending of August have come from either London or the North West, which is inauspicious for Aston Villa, Middlesbrough, Newcastle, Portsmouth and Sunderland.

And Wigan can fail to remember it.
No squad that has faced West Ham on the opening day of the Premier League has ruined August on peak.

The bad reports for West Ham is that they have simply once topped the Premier League in 13 seasons and that was for a solitary day (22nd August 2006) when a class game record allowed them to play their second match (v Watford) previous to everybody else.

Bye bye, Liverpool.

No squad that completed in fourth position the prior season before has ever finished August on peak.

And stop sneered Everton.

They are the simply squad from the top five never to have been top at the ending of August.

Those who have spotted Bolton still hanging around can respire a sigh of respite.

It has been six years since an English boss has ended the opening month on peak (Glenn Hoddle’s Tottenham).

Which leaves us with North London contenders Arsenal and Tottenham.

In the preceding ten years, the ending of month table toppers has either been a squad who completed in the crown half the year before or a recently promoted side.

In the precedent decade a group who completed the preceding season in the bottom half have never been primary at the ending of August – bad reports for Spurs, who came 11th last year.
